Identify what areas need organizing

Do you ever find yourself feeling overwhelmed by the clutter in your home? It can be difficult to know where to start when it comes to organizing, but identifying the most cluttered areas is a great place to begin. Whether it’s your bedroom, kitchen, or living room that needs attention, focusing on one area at a time can help break down the task into more manageable chunks.

By taking the time to declutter and organize your space, you’ll be amazed at how much more at peace you’ll feel in your own home. Also, by recognizing what areas in your home need the most attention, you’ll be able to tailor your organizing plan and focus on areas that are truly important to you.

Research self-storage options

If you’re really tight on space, utilizing self-storage can be an effective way to help organize and declutter your home. Self-storage is a great solution for long-term use or as needed when extra items need to be stored away. Many facilities even offer climate control options so that valuable items are safe from the elements or extreme temperatures.

Look into local self-storage options to make the most of what you have and maximize your available space. Keep in mind that self-storage comes in a variety of sizes and prices, so be sure to research your options before committing.

Utilize vertical space

If you’re struggling to find space for all your belongings, don’t forget about the vertical space in your home! Installing shelves, hanging racks, and wall-mounted storage systems can make a huge difference in freeing up floor space and keeping your home organized. Vertical storage is especially useful in small spaces or rooms with high ceilings, where floor space is limited.

By taking advantage of vertical space, you can store more items without sacrificing aesthetics, since sleek and modern storage solutions are available to complement any decor style. So don’t let clutter take over your home, try utilizing your vertical space today!

Invest in multipurpose furniture

Investing in furniture that serves a dual purpose can be a smart move if you’re looking to make the most of your living space. Ottomans with built-in storage or coffee tables with drawers offer a convenient option for stowing away items you want kept out of sight, while also providing a functional place to rest your feet or set down a cup of coffee.

With limited square footage, every inch counts, making it important to maximize the potential of each piece of furniture in your home. Whether you’re looking to declutter or just seeking a way to make your space more efficient, investing in multipurpose furniture can be a practical and stylish solution.

Use baskets to organize smaller items

Are you tired of smaller items cluttering up your home? It’s time to consider using baskets for the organization. Not only do they make a stylish addition to any room, but they also provide an easy way to keep things neat and tidy. Magazines, books, and toys can all find a new home in one of these versatile containers.

The best part? Baskets come in all shapes, sizes, and colors, so you can choose one that fits perfectly with your décor. Say goodbye to messy spaces and hello to a more organized home with the help of baskets.

Repurpose everyday items

With a little bit of creativity, everyday items can be repurposed in all sorts of ways. Take mason jars, for example. Not only are they great for canning and preserving food, but they also make for stylish and functional household items. Need a vase for your fresh flowers? Mason jar to the rescue. Or maybe you’re in need of a cute and rustic way to store your kitchen utensils? Mason jar, of course!

With their versatile shape and design, it’s no wonder that mason jars have become a staple in many households for both practical and decorative purposes. So, the next time you’re looking to spruce up your home, consider repurposing those trusty mason jars in a new and exciting way.
